There’s a cottage in the woods, overgrown with moss, choked by ivy, and sealed with gaudy, tinted petals. There’s a gutted hut by a jutting drawbridge overgrown with eglantine and ivy and framed by a running creek that cuts through the fog like a silver thread. Stained-glass windows wink with a kaleidoscope of colours that have lost their lustre, and a jutting chimney reaches up and into the fog. There’s a crescent-moon hole carved into the wooden door, and the cottage - however lonely it might appear - heaves a sigh as if in tune with the wind.
There’s a golden glow behind those burnished, rattling windows. There’s a coil of smoke that rises from the spout of the cypress chimney. There’s a creak to the old floorboards, and a formless, silhouetted figure that passes by the candle’s warm glow. There’s a black cat with golden eyes who lingers by the windowsills, sitting by the rosemary and lavender plants with an ever-watchful gaze. There’s a groan to the door, and an absence of dust along the windows.
There’s a cottage in the woods where the stale scent of dead things haunts the cold midnight air.
Vilde Eres runs a small apothecary out of an isolated cottage located in the heart of the Shroud. It is within a house cluttered with potted plants, overgrown vines, gnarled tapestries of swelling tree roots, and stagnant spirits that he conducts his business. Vilde proudly grows, gathers, and cultivates all of his own ingredients, refusing to brew anything but the best to those that will pay for his wares. The witch is capable of concocting lustrous fortune potions, ghastly poisons, luck charms, sleeping droughts, and much, much more. Many of his potions are of his own creations, and he is ever eager to test them on willing (or unwilling) subjects.
In addition to his apothecary, Vilde offers his spellwork as a product of trade. Ready and willing to perform curses, hexes or charms for customers willing to pay the correct price, his manipulations are as eclectic and eccentric as he is. His erudite understanding of the human body makes him an adept healer at mending a range of maladies, from cuts and bruises to more unorthodox complications. He’s a good healer, and he’s excellent at keeping secrets.
In personality, Vilde’s disposition is pleasant, airy, dreamy. Optimistic and infallibly hopeful, eager to find a friend in everything, and anything. Trusting to the point of fault, and kind to the point of naïveté. Vilde is intelligent, ritualistic, curious, insightful, and softly-spoken. He’s greedy, power-hungry, and ravenous for knowledge. He’s easily swayed, mild-mannered, and ever so woefully manic. Odd, and eccentric, he can be endearing, just as he can be surprising.
